Mössbauer Spectroscopy and Surface Analysis

Mössbauer Spectroscopy and Surface Analysis


The Mössbauer Spectroscopy and Surface Analysis Group is devoted to research of thin and ultrathin films, surfaces and nanostructures. The group employs a remarkable variety of experimental approaches that include both the production of films and / or their surface modification by molecular beam epitaxy or magnetron sputtering and the characterization of their physicochemical properties by spectroscopic techniques (XPS, AES, Mössbauer), diffraction (LEED) and microscopy (STM, LEEM).

Fluorescence and Molecular Biophysics

Fluorescence and Molecular Biophysics


Structure, dynamics, interactions and reactivity of biomolecules, using advanced methods of laser-induced fluorescence with high temporal (ps-s) and spatial (nm-µm) resolution: fluorescence micro-spectroscopy (FLIM, FLIM-Phasor, FRET, TRA-IM, FCS) and second harmonic generation (SHG). Applications to native and synthetic macromolecular systems, cellular organules and living cells

Lasers, nanostructures and materials processing (LANAMAP)

Lasers, nanostructures and materials processing (LANAMAP)


The activity of the Group is focused in the investigation of the physicochemical processes involved in the micro- and nanofabrication of materials by laser ablation and irradiation in the nano- and femtosecond temporal domains and in the ultraviolet to infrared spectral range. Our interest is the understanding and description of the mechanisms that govern the laser-material interaction from a fundamental perspective, in the ablative and sub-ablative regimes, and the development of laser control strategies by application of advanced methods of manipulation of the pulsed laser radiation.
